DID YOU KNOW?

CHALLENGE

This word has travelled, via Old English 'calenge', Old French 'calonge' from

Latin 'columnia', false accusation. The original sense remains in the

English 'calumny'; but with the shifting forms came a shifting

meaning. The first use in English was an accusation; but

since the old way of answering an accusation was

to fight a duel, to accuse was the same

as to summon to combat, to challenge.
